In continuation of ny telegram LTo.305 -dated the
12th Septenber 1930 to your address.
I have the honour to forward herewith 4 copies
in English and Arabic of the "Senad", which Ills Excellency
the ohaildi would like Shailch Sir iChazaal ZQian to sign,
before he agrees to the transfer of any house property
by any of his subjects to the Shaikh of I.Iohaminerah in pay-
rnent of their debts to him.
2. On the receipt of this Sanad duly signed by Shaikh
Sir IQiazai-l IChan, and countersigned by His I.IaJesty T s
states
--inister, the Shaikh that he is prepared to agree to
the conveyance of the properties referred to, and to sign
the necessary documents making Shaikh Sir Khazaal Elian the
local owner for his lifetime.
-he Shaikh has further intimated to me that the
above is conditional on his also receiving a formal letter
from you as the Kon T ble the Political Resident A senior ranking political representative (equivalent to a Consul General) from the diplomatic corps of the Government of India or one of its subordinate provincial governments, in charge of a Political Residency. in the
-ersian -ulf, promising on behalf of His I.Iajesty's Govern
ment that at no time during the future, or during the
present life of the Ex Shaikh of ' ohamnerah will the
Persian Government be allowed to interfere with, claim or
touch any of the properties of the ^x Shaikh of kohomier ah
that i.my be situate within the State of I-uwait.

About this item

Content

This file contains correspondence between British officials regarding debts owed by a number of Kuwaiti merchants to Shaikh Khaz‘al bin Jābir al-Ka‘bī, the former ruler of Mohammerah [Khorramshahr].

The file also contains correspondence between British officials and the ruler of Kuwait, Shaikh Aḥmad al-Jābir Āl Ṣabāḥ and Mirza Mohammad, Khaz'al's agent in Basra which discusses this issue.
